Korean-Nigerian Mother Alleges Rough Handling of Newborn During NIN Registration
A Korean woman living in Nigeria with her Nigerian husband has described a frustrating experience while trying to register her newborn for passport processing. She alleged that an official handled the baby’s fingers roughly while attempting to capture fingerprints. She said the incident made her feel like leaving Nigeria for the first time. According to her, the family visited the NIN office three times because of repeated problems. She said the staff member handling their case fell ill and the required information was stored on his phone. On their final visit, the baby’s photograph was taken in a crowded office where some people were coughing.
